The production of good-quality sheep milk requires an adequate diet and efficient feed utilization. In intensive production systems, increased fecundity and higher milk production often lead to negative energy balance and ketosis, known as pregnancy toxemia, in ewes. Negative energy balance in ewes is responsible for reduced production and consequent fertility issues and can even result in the ewe’s death. Supplementing the diet with the yeast probiotic Actisaf® Sc 47 helps improve the energy balance and milk performance.

Reducing effects of pregnancy toxemia

Supplementing dairy ewes with a combination of Actisaf® Sc 47, Safmannan®, and Selsaf® during the peripartum period can provide significant benefits. Actisaf® Sc 47 helps maintain a healthy rumen environment and improve nutrient availability, while Safmannan® supports gut health and immune function. Selsaf®, a selenium-enriched yeast, can neutralize the oxidative stress associated with negative energy balance. This comprehensive approach helps mitigate the risk of subclinical pregnancy toxemia, a prevalent issue in intensively raised flocks, ultimately improving ewe and lamb performance and survival.

Strengthening Ewe Antioxidant Defenses

The inclusion of Selsaf®, a selenium-enriched yeast, in the Actisaf® and Safmannan® supplementation program for ewes during the parturition period provides significant benefits to their antioxidant status. The activity of superoxide dismutase (SOD) in the blood plasma was significantly increased in the Actisaf®+ Safmannan®+ Selsaf® group compared to the control. SOD is a crucial first line of defense against reactive oxygen species, catalyzing the dismutation of superoxide anions and reducing the risk of oxidative cell damage. By enhancing this key antioxidant enzyme, Selsaf® helps support the ewes’ natural defenses during the physiologically demanding transition around lambing.
